Tender, fall-off-the-bone chicken drumettes glazed with a sweet-spicy molasses-soy BBQ sauce, finished with a golden-brown, caramelized broiled crust. Perfect for game-day feasts or easy family dinners, these wings combine smoky depth with sticky-sweet flavor in a no-fuss crockpot method.
8-10 chicken drumettes
1/4 cup brown sugar
2 tablespoons chili paste (adjust for heat)
1/4 cup soy sauce
2 tablespoons molasses
1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
2 cloves garlic, minced
1/2 teaspoon salt
Pat chicken dry and season with salt
In a bowl, mix brown sugar, chili paste, soy sauce, molasses, vinegar, and garlic
Place chicken in the crockpot and pour sauce over
Cook on LOW for 6 hours
Preheat oven broiler, transfer chicken to a lined baking sheet, and broil for 12-15 minutes until crispy
Garnish with wing sauce drizzle (optional)
Use halal-certified chicken if required
Taste test chili paste to adjust spice level
Broil at a safe distance to avoid burning
